Grading System for High School Students

 

Grades are determined by calculating the academic (work) average and the progress during the grade reporting period.

 

Step 1. Determine seat time hours for the student during the grade reporting period. Students must have 16 hours by mid-term and/or 36 hours by end of term in order to qualify for a recommended grade.

 

Step 2. Determine the academic (work) average completed during the grade reporting period.

 

Step 3. Using the percentage obtained in step 2, determine which of the five grade scales (I - V) will be used for calculating the grade during the reporting period using the chart below:

  Work Average Scale
 

93-100

I
  90 - 92 II
  87 - 89 III
  83 - 86 IV
  80 - 82 V

 

Step 4. Using Northstar, determine the student's progress during the grade reporting period.

 

Step 5. Using the correct grade scale for the student (I - V) locate the student's progress and grade on the scale.

Attendance (1) + Work (2) + Progress (3) = Grade

 

(1) Attendance is required; 16 hours minimum at midterm and 36 hours minimum by end of grade reporting term.

 

(2) Work is the average of all academic course work completed by the student during the grade reporting time frame. Due to the competency standards set, 80% is the lowest average possible.

 

(3) Progress is measured by dividing the competency hours the student completed during the grading period by the hours the student was enrolled during this same grading period. This calculation is easily accessible in the Northstar information system; however, this progress percentage does not directly equate to a letter grade.
